Question:
Will this lock e98888 work with a 2 5/16 bulldog coupler? The descrition had surge coupler.
asked by: Leon W
Expert Reply:
Good news, I can help you figure out if this coupler lock will fit your Bulldog coupler.
As long as your pin diameter on the Bulldog coupler is larger than a 1/4 inch and the span is no bigger than 3-3/8 inches, then this coupler lock will work for you.
I pulled the Bulldog coupler # BD028287 you had looked at from our warehouse and a similar style 2-5/16 inch # BD028499 and measured the size of the lock pin that goes in the coupler. It measured 5/16 inch diameter and a length of 2-3/4 inches. I tried the etrailer.com lock, # e98888, in the coupler and it fit and did keep the collar lock from opening.
